Button, Royal Navy
Button worn on blazer of the Royal Navy. Flat brass blazer button with engraved Naval crown on flat ground. The front of the button has a small amount of corrosion.
On the reverse of the button the maker is inscribed - J.R. GAUNT & SON LONDON
Reference to the button can be found in ‘Buttons: A Guide for Collectors’ by Gwen Squire 1972 (No. 20, Plate 40).
